Aldoth
Aldoth is a hamlet in the civil parish of Holme Abbey in Cumberland, Cumbria, England. St Mungo’s Church, Bromfield

St Mungo's Church is in the village of Bromfield, Cumbria, England. It is an active Anglican parish church in the deanery of Solway, the archdeaconry of West Cumberland and the diocese of Carlisle. St Mungo’s Church, Bromfield is situated 2 miles southeast of Aldoth.
St Mary’s Church

St Mary's Church is in the village of Abbeytown, Cumbria, England. It is an active Anglican parish church in the deanery of Solway, the archdeaconry of West Cumberland, and the diocese of Carlisle. St Mary’s Church is situated 2½ miles northeast of Aldoth.

Highlaws

Highlaws is a hamlet in the civil parish of Holme Abbey in Cumbria, England. It is situated approximately two-and-a-quarter miles south-west of Abbeytown, one-and-a-half miles east of Pelutho, and one mile to the north of Aldoth.
Pelutho

Pelutho is a hamlet in the civil parish of Holme St. Cuthbert in Cumbria, historically in Cumberland, England. It is situated on the B5301 road between the towns of Aspatria and Silloth.
Mealrigg

Mealrigg is a settlement in the civil parish of Westnewton, close to the boundary with the civil parish of Holme St. Cuthbert in Cumbria, England. Mealrigg is situated one mile north-west of Westnewton, a quarter-of-a-mile east of New Cowper, and half-a-mile south of Aikshaw. Mealrigg is situated 1½ miles southwest of Aldoth.
